True or False The image of a translation is always congruent to the pre-image.

Mathematics
2 answers:
posledela4 years ago
8 0
True. The image of a translation is always congruent to the pre-image.

Proof: every point of the pre-image is move exactly the same distance and the same direction. That means that the shape stay the same but it is just located in a different place.

The circumference of a circle can be found by using 2\pir, or \pi * d.

Since we are given the circumference of the circle, 30\pi, you can find the diameter by solving for the diameter (after substituting in the circumference) in the formula for circumference.

30\pi =\pi *d

To cancel out \pi you can divide both sides of the equation by pi. Now you have:

30 = d

Therefore the diameter of the circle is 30 inches.
